Flo Milli, born Tamia Monique Carter on January 9, 2000, is an American rapper and singer-songwriter. She gained recognition with her 2018 single 'Beef FloMix' and its 2019 follow-up, 'In the Party,' both of which went viral on TikTok; the latter received platinum certification from the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A). In late 2019, she signed a recording contract with '94 Sounds, an imprint of RCA Records founded by Justin Goldman. Both singles served as lead tracks for her debut mixtape, Ho, Why Is You Here? (2020), which received critical acclaim and was included on Rolling Stone's list of the Greatest Hip Hop Albums of All Time. The mixtape achieved moderate success on the Billboard 200 chart. Her debut studio album, You Still Here, Ho? (2022), was similarly well-received despite not charting, and included the single 'Conceited,' which was certified gold by the RIAA. Her second studio album, Fine Ho, Stay (2024), featured the lead single 'Never Lose Me,' which became her first entry on the US Billboard Hot 100, reaching the top 20. Carter was nominated for Best New Artist at the 2020 BET Hip Hop Awards and the 2021 BET Awards.
